Self-closing breakaway valve assemblies

1. A self-closing breakaway valve assembly comprising:
- A. a first valve housing having a first rotatable valve member rotatably mounted therein, said first valve housing and first rotatable valve member each having a bore formed therethrough, said bores being aligned when said first rotatable valve member is in an open position to provide a passage through said first valve housing, and said first rotatable valve member spring biased to rotate to a closed position wherein the bores of said first rotatable valve member and said first valve housing are misaligned to block the passage through said first valve housing;
B. a second valve housing having a second rotatable valve member rotatably mounted therein, said second valve housing and said second rotatable valve member each having a bore formed therethrough, said bores being aligned when said second rotatable valve member is in an open position to provide a passage through said second valve housing, and said second rotatable valve member spring biased to rotate to a closed position wherein the bores of said second rotatable valve member and said second valve housing are misaligned to block the passage through said second valve housing;
C. frangible means connecting said first and second valve housings with the bores formed therethrough in alignment; and
D. trigger means positioned within the aligned bores formed through the connected first and second valve housings, said trigger means engaged between said first and second rotatable valve members to hold them in their open positions, wherein separation of said first and second valve housings upon fracture of the frangible connecting means releases said trigger means engaged between said first and second rotatable valve members and permits said first and second rotatble valve members to rotate to their closed positions.

Abstract
Self-closing breakaway valve assemblies comprised of two valve housings each having a rotatable valve member rotatably mounted therein and spring biased to close. The valve housings are connected by frangible means and the rotatable valve members are held open by trigger means interposed therebetween. The trigger means releases upon separation of the valve housings to permit the rotatable valve members to close. The trigger member may be heat-softenable wherein the rotatable valve members are released to close upon application of heat as well as upon separation of the valve housing.
